As social media brings the public closer to celebrities, many celebrities are choosing to keep their children out of the spotlight. Given what we're learning about the effects of growing up in the public eye, this certainly seems like the safest choice. Many of the stars and child stars who emerged through Disney Channel and 'The Mickey Mouse Club' are now adults who are examining their past experiences and sharing the dark truths about exploitation and abuse.

Child labor is banned around the world for good reasons, but the entertainment industry has always been a controversial exception. Click through this gallery to read about what it's really like to be a child star.
